> This is my first install FreeBSD 2.2.6 on CD-ROM.
> Arise a error when I build my custom kernel.
> This is my type list:
>   1.  cd /usr/src/sys/i386/conf
>   2.  cp GENERIC MYKERNEL
>   3.  vi MYKERNEL
>   4.  /usr/sbin/config MYKERNEL
>   5.  cd ../../compile/MYKERNEL
>   6.  make depend
>   7.  make
> when I type 'make',a error message arise.
> The error message is 
> '../../netinet/if_ether.h:117:field 'sin_addr' has incomplete type'
> '../../netinet/if_ether.h:118:field 'sin_srcaddr' has incomplete type'
> 'STOP'  .
> I don't know what's wrong. 
> How can I do?
> Can you help me?

This would hint that your kernel source is somehow corrupted.  Try
removing /usr/src/sys/ and reinstalling it from the CDROM.
